数据库双节点部署什么意思

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库双节点部署是指在数据库系统中同时使用两个节点进行部署和运行的一种架构方式。每个节点都具有独立的硬件和软件资源,并且可以独立地处理数据库的读写操作。下面是数据库双节点部署的一些重要意义和特点:

    1. 高可用性:通过双节点部署,可以实现数据库的高可用性。当其中一个节点发生故障或停机时,另一个节点可以立即接管并继续提供服务,从而避免数据库系统的单点故障。

    2. 故障恢复:在双节点部署中,如果一个节点发生故障,可以使用另一个节点的备份数据进行故障恢复。这可以大大缩短恢复时间,并减少因故障而导致的业务中断。

    3. 负载均衡:通过双节点部署,可以将数据库的读写操作均匀地分布到两个节点上,从而实现负载均衡。这可以提高数据库的整体性能和吞吐量,并减少单节点的压力。

    4. 数据冗余:双节点部署通常会使用数据复制技术,将数据实时复制到两个节点上。这样可以实现数据的冗余存储,提高数据的可靠性和可恢复性。

    5. 扩展性:双节点部署可以方便地进行水平扩展。当数据库的负载增加时,可以通过增加更多的节点来分担负载,从而提高系统的扩展性和性能。

    需要注意的是,数据库双节点部署需要合适的硬件和软件支持,以及一定的配置和管理工作。此外,双节点部署还可能涉及到数据同步、故障切换、负载均衡等技术和策略。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库双节点部署是指在数据库系统中,将数据库实例分布在两个独立的节点上,以实现高可用性和容错性。双节点部署主要包括主节点和备节点,主节点用于处理客户端请求并执行数据库操作,而备节点则负责实时复制主节点的数据并提供冗余备份。

    在数据库双节点部署中,主节点是负责处理所有的读写请求和数据操作的节点。它负责接收客户端请求并执行相应的数据库操作,同时将执行结果返回给客户端。主节点也负责将数据的变更操作记录在日志中,以便备节点能够实时复制这些变更。

    备节点是主节点的复制副本,它通过实时复制主节点的数据来保持与主节点的一致性。备节点不处理客户端请求,而是持续地从主节点复制数据,并保持与主节点的数据一致。当主节点发生故障或不可用时,备节点可以快速接管主节点的工作,并继续提供服务。

    双节点部署可以提供高可用性和容错性。当主节点发生故障时,备节点可以立即接管工作,保证系统的持续运行。另外,双节点部署还可以通过备份数据来提供容错能力,当数据发生意外损坏或丢失时,可以通过备节点进行恢复。

    总之,数据库双节点部署通过将数据库实例分布在两个独立的节点上,提供了高可用性和容错性。它可以保证数据库系统的持续运行,并在主节点故障时快速恢复服务。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    数据库双节点部署是指在数据库系统中,将数据库分布在两个节点上进行部署和运行。这种部署方式旨在提高数据库的可用性和容错性,以确保在其中一个节点发生故障或停机的情况下,数据库仍然可以继续运行。

    在数据库双节点部署中,通常会有一个主节点和一个备用节点。主节点负责处理所有的数据库操作和事务,而备用节点则用于实时复制主节点的数据,并在主节点发生故障时接管其功能。

    下面是数据库双节点部署的操作流程:

    1. 确定节点角色:首先需要确定哪个节点将充当主节点,哪个节点将充当备用节点。通常情况下,主节点应该是性能较好的节点,备用节点应该是备份和恢复功能较好的节点。

    2. 安装数据库软件:在每个节点上安装相应的数据库软件,例如MySQL、Oracle等。确保两个节点上的数据库软件版本和配置相同。

    3. 创建主节点:在主节点上创建数据库实例,并进行相应的配置。配置包括数据库参数、日志文件位置、数据文件位置等。

    4. 复制数据到备用节点:使用数据库备份和恢复工具,将主节点上的数据复制到备用节点上。这可以通过物理备份、逻辑备份或增量备份等方式来实现。

    5. 启动备用节点:在备用节点上启动数据库实例,并进行相应的配置。确保备用节点能够实时复制主节点的数据。

    6. 配置主备关系:在主节点和备用节点之间建立主备关系。这通常需要在主节点上配置主备复制的参数,以便备用节点可以实时复制主节点的数据。

    7. 测试故障转移:模拟主节点故障,观察备用节点是否能够自动接管主节点的功能。如果故障转移成功,数据库将继续在备用节点上运行。

    8. 监控和维护:定期监控数据库的运行状态,确保主备节点之间的数据同步和一致性。同时,定期进行数据库备份和恢复,以防止数据丢失。

    通过数据库双节点部署,可以提高数据库的可用性和容错性,减少数据库停机时间和数据丢失的风险。但需要注意的是,双节点部署并不能完全消除数据库故障的风险,仍然需要定期进行备份和维护工作。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部